12.2023 | inne | salesforce | saql
Budując raport w Salesforce Analytics Studio z wykorzystaniem języka SAQL, możemy natrafić na potrzebę szybkiej podmiany jednej z wartości zwracanych przez dany wymiar (dimension).
Przykład
Chcemy wyświetlić diagram typu TreeMap, który pokazuje ilość transakcji w podziale na kanał zakupowy (”Order_Type”).
Wymiar, opisany jako “Order_Type”, zwaraca nam wartości typu [’departure store’, ‘phone’, ‘web’].
W naszym zestawieniu, chcemy jednak na wykresie pokazać wartość ‘ecommerce’, zamiast ‘web’.
Potrzebujemy takiej zmiany tylko na użytek pojedynczego diagramu.
W tym celu, najszybciej dokonać podmiany, poprzez poniższy kod:
q = load "Order_Channel_Source";
q = group q by 'Order_Type';
q = foreach q generate
case when 'Order_Type' == "web" then "ecommerce"
else 'Order_Type' end as 'Order_Type',
count(q) as 'A';
q = order q by 'Order_Type' asc;
q = limit q 2000;
Wdrażam rozwiązania analityczne, buduję raporty zarządcze i pomagam zrozumieć dane.
Korzystam z Google Marketing Cloud, Microsoft Power BI, Google Cloud oraz Python.
Pracowałem m.in. dla Credit Suisse, Phonak, Hansaton, Unitron, Nestle, IBM, Play.
Jestem współtwórcą grupy Hexe Capital SA.
Zapraszam do lektury i współpracy.
Krzysztof Surowiecki
Chcę porozmawiać o współpracy →Moje certyfikaty